Handover: Relaypond websocket compression

For the sync: I tested permessage-deflate on Relaypond's fan-out tier. CPU cost on small frames outweighs bandwidth savings below ~1KB, so compression is now gated by payload size. Context takeover stays off to cap memory per connection; we accept the ratio hit. Mobile clients saw 30% less data, desktop unchanged. Mira owns tuning from here. Don't re-enable takeover without load-testing the edge nodes first. The current production settings are listed directly below.

settings of kawif-tawig:
[pelok]
port = 5432
region = lower-3
host = pelok.crelvocorp.example
team = fraox
timeout_ms = 750
retries = 7

**Alert: metrik-sidecar flush backlog**

The metrik-sidecar buffers counters from the host process and flushes to the Tallyhouse aggregator every ten seconds. This alert fires when the flush backlog exceeds 50,000 points, usually indicating aggregator backpressure or a serialization regression. Check the recent changes to the encoding path before approving any rollback. If the backlog persists past thirty minutes, report it to the sidecar owners at the address below.

escalation mailbox, yafog-kafof: eliok@xolmarcloud.local

Action item: The Relayn deploy-status bot silently dropped updates when the pipeline API paginated results, so responders believed a rollback had completed when it had not. We will add pagination handling, a staleness banner, and an integration test. Until merged, verify deploy state directly in the pipeline console, documented at the page below.

runbook for kahop-kajop: https://rundeck.ordinio.test/display/secrets/pipeline/issue/pages/repo/browse/e5732776e07d1285107e5aeb